#0363bf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0363bf is composed of 1.2% red, 38.8% green and 74.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.4% cyan, 48.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 209.4 degrees, a saturation of 96.9% and a lightness of 38%. #0363bf color hex could be obtained by blending #06c6ff with #00007f.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

#0363bf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0363bf has RGB values of R:3, G:99, B:191 and CMYK values of C:0.98, M:0.48, Y:0,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 222143.

Shades and Tints of #0363bf
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000911 is the darkest color, while #fdfe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0363bf
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5d6165 is the less saturated color, while #0363bf is the most saturated one.
